Understanding Video Compression Fundamentals
Before diving into the how, let's grasp the why. Video compression reduces file size without significantly impacting visual quality. This is achieved by removing redundant data and employing clever encoding algorithms. Think of it like packing a suitcase – you strategically choose what to include to maximize space.
Key Compression Concepts:
- Codec: This is the software (or hardware) that performs the compression and decompression. Popular codecs include H.264, H.265 (HEVC), and VP9. YouTube heavily utilizes VP9 and H.264.
- Bitrate: This measures the amount of data used per second of video. Lower bitrates mean smaller files, but potentially lower quality. Finding the right balance is crucial.
- Resolution: The dimensions of your video (e.g., 1080p, 720p, 480p). Lower resolutions lead to smaller file sizes.
Impactful Steps to Compress Your Videos
Now for the practical steps. These methods will help you achieve YouTube-like compression:
1. Choose the Right Video Editor/Compressor
Many tools offer robust video compression features. Some popular options include:
- HandBrake: A free, open-source video transcoder with extensive settings for fine-tuning compression. Excellent for learning the intricacies of video compression.
- Adobe Premiere Pro/After Effects: Professional-grade software offering powerful compression capabilities, but requires a subscription.
- Filmora: User-friendly software with a good balance of features and ease of use. Provides various pre-sets for different platforms, including YouTube.
- Online Video Compressors: Several websites provide free online video compression services. These are convenient for smaller files but may have limitations.

2. Optimize Your Video Settings
Regardless of the software, these settings significantly impact compression:
- Codec Selection: Prioritize H.264 or H.265 for compatibility and good quality.
- Bitrate Adjustment: Start with a lower bitrate and gradually increase it until you find a balance between file size and quality. YouTube's recommended bitrates are a good starting point.
- Resolution Downscaling: Consider reducing resolution if your video doesn't require high detail. 720p often provides a great compromise between quality and file size.
- Frame Rate: Lowering the frame rate (e.g., from 60fps to 30fps) can also reduce file size, though the impact might be less noticeable than resolution changes.
3. Pre-Production Considerations
Optimizing your video before compression is crucial:
- High-Quality Source Material: Start with good footage. Poor quality footage won't magically improve through compression.
- Efficient Editing: Remove unnecessary scenes and keep your video concise. Less footage means less to compress.
